1 Incisive most nearly means:
58% Answer Correctly
stern
corroborate
keen
combative

Solution
The definition for incisive is "Impressively direct and decisive." Used in a sentence: Samir's incisive leadership made him the natural choice for president of the company. The definition for combative is "eager to fight.", the definition for stern is "Harsh, severe.", and the definition for corroborate is "To support with evidence."

2 Sarah thought George's ploy of borrowing her notes was a cowardly way to ask her out.
61% Answer Correctly
strategem
abate
gargantuan
flourish

Solution
The definition for ploy is "A contrived plan." Used in a sentence: Sarah thought George's ploy of borrowing her notes was a cowardly way to ask her out. The definition for gargantuan is "gigantic.", the definition for flourish is "To make bold, sweeping gestures.", and the definition for abate is "Become less in amount or intensity."

3 Crocuses bloom at the onset of spring, sometimes even before the snow melts.
89% Answer Correctly
start
illuminate
augment
pathos

Solution
The definition for onset is "Beginning." Used in a sentence: Crocuses bloom at the onset of spring, sometimes even before the snow melts. The definition for augment is "to make greater.", the definition for pathos is "Sympathetic pity.", and the definition for illuminate is "To make clear."

4 Ron was worried when the usually punctual Amanda was late for the show.
78% Answer Correctly
repel
prompt
turmoil
salvage

Solution
The definition for punctual is "On time." Used in a sentence: Ron was worried when the usually punctual Amanda was late for the show. The definition for repel is "to resist, reject.", the definition for salvage is "To save from ruin.", and the definition for turmoil is "Extreme confusion, agitation."

5 The jealous actress called her understudy's performance a ridiculous pantomime.
61% Answer Correctly
prune
appalling
charade
recrimination

Solution
The definition for pantomime is "Telling a story through gestures." Used in a sentence: The jealous actress called her understudy's performance a ridiculous pantomime. The definition for recrimination is "a retaliatory accusation.", the definition for appalling is "Inspiring dismay or disgust.", and the definition for prune is "To reduce by removing excess."
